Paul Berdiner, 89
March 23, 2015
Paul Berdiner of Washington Boro passed away Monday, March 23,rd at the age of 89.
He was born in Gilberton, Pa. in 1925, The son of John and Cathryn (McCabe) Berdiner. Paul shared 69 wonderful years of marriage with Joan (Campbell) Berdiner .
In 1943 he enlisted in the US Navy and served 3 years as a member of the Naval Armed Guards, serving mostly in the North Atlantic Theater as a gunner aboard the
SSJohn Phillips Sousa, SS Montclair Victory, and the SSBenjamin Silliman. He also participated in the D Day invasion of Normandy.
Paul was a longtime member of the Grace United Methodist Church in Millersville, Pa. He was also a member of the Millersville VFW Post
He and his wife built and operated the Brereton Manor Personal Care Home in Washington Boro for 40 years. He also was employed by ITT Grinell.
Although his last years were spent living with Alzheimers Disease, he never lost his ability to enjoy his family and friends, who surrounded him with love and caring.
He was able to live in his home until the last week when illness prevented that.

For many years Paul enjoyed raising and training thoroughbred horses on his farm in Washington Boro and racing them at the Penn National and Delaware race tracks.
He also loved playing softball, mostly with the church leagues and later played with the Willow Street Ole Stars, until he was 79 years of age. He was also a lifelong New York Yankees fan.
